That's because pre-SP1 didn't have the rain effects. Those use polygons and animations (ala what the Lotusim L-39 does). We've hit some sort of limit in FSX that's only appearing on certain systems and it causes the artifacts to start up when you cross it. We're trying to determine what the limit is and why it's system specific...

Can someone please tell me what I need to add to the config file to select the VC option with no ice? I have to do it manually because the damn Configuration Manager never saves anything :(
Did not test it, but I think you can do it this way:
  1. go to C:\Program Files\Microsoft Games\Microsoft Flight Simulator X\SimObjects\Airplanes\PMDG_JS4100\model
  2. open file model.cfg
  3. change the line "interior=..\Model.VC\pmdg_j41_interior" into "interior=..\Model.VC\pmdg_j41_interior_NO_ICE"
  4. for no ice and no props change it to "interior=..\Model.VC\pmdg_j41_interior_NO_ICE_NO_WINGS"

Good luck!
